Originally Posted by lacubs
is Showtime complete with Paramount + now? can you still get it with Hulu? i trying to figure out if I to i need switch my Showtime to Paramount +, thanks
"Paramount+ with Showtime" streaming service launches on June 27, replacing the separate Paramount+ and Showtime streaming services.

As far as I can tell, the Showtime linear channel service will be rebranded "Paramount+ with Showtime" at a later date this year, yet to be announced. In the meantime Showtime linear (and its Showtime Anytime streaming app) should continue as normal. The Hulu add-on Showtime service is technically Showtime linear, so for you, lacubs, there should be no change at this time. For anyone that has Showtime through Prime Video Channels, Apple TV Channels, or YouTube TV, that is also Showtime linear.

https://www.hollywoodreporter.com/tv...73e828aa12daf1

Add Paramount+ to the list of streamers that have removed content from its platform in exchange for a tax write-off.

The Paramount Global-backed streamer has canceled Grease: Rise of the Pink Ladies after a single season, reversed its decision on a season two pickup for the animated and kids-focused Star Trek: Prodigy, axed competition series Queen of the Universe after two seasons and nixed The Game revival after two seasons. Additionally, all four shows will be removed from Paramount+ as the conglomerate joins Disney and Warner Bros. Discovery in taking tax write-offs for underperforming series. The news comes as Paramount+ will incorporate Showtime into the platform in the U.S. on Tuesday.
